Software QA Engineer I Salary in Abington, MA

What is the salary range of a Software QA Engineer I?

As of November 01, 2025, the average salary for a Software QA Engineer I in Abington, MA is $79,200 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$38.

However, a Software QA Engineer I's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$89,899
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$73,500 to $84,800
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$68,310

How Experience Level Affects Software QA Engineer I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Software QA Engineer I's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$78,766
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$79,370
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$80,630
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$80,882
  • Expert (over 8 years): $81,050

What Skills Can Increase a Software QA Engineer I's Salary?

Demanded Skills for the Role:

  • Analysis (Mentioned in 4.71% Job Postings): Analysis is the process of considering something carefully or using statistical methods in order to understand it or explain it.
  • Test Automation (Mentioned in 3.05% Job Postings): Leveraging automation tools to maintain test data, execute tests, and analyze test results to improve software quality.
  • Automated Testing (Mentioned in 1.76% Job Postings): Test automation is the use of software to control the execution of tests and the comparison of predicted to actual outcomes.
